Teksoft’s SpeedBooster 2.0!
![]()
Everyone loves speed. I’m no different in that I’ll go to more dangerous means to get my speed. Sometimes I overclock my processors and make them run faster then what they were designed for. This of course is potentially damaging. Now, there’s a new way to squeeze more out of your mobile device’s processor without going into that dangerous overclocking territory by using Teksoft’s SpeedBooster 2.0. So how does it work? Looking at the demo video, my first thoughts are it works by allowing you to prioritize thread process priority. As a processor can only handle one job it can assign how much attention it gives to each application. So by increasing the priority level, it will give whichever application you choose more processor love. Some of its other features appear to be some various registry tweaks as well as a nice benchmarking program. I’m looking forward to giving this thing a try as from a technical standpoint – it oozes of potential.
